Switzerland has invested $110 million in the Azerbaijani economy over the past 22 years, Ambassador of Switzerland to Azerbaijan Muriel Peneveyre said at a press conference, Trend reports on Dec. 13.

According to Peneveyre, the World Bank is one of the main executors of projects financed by Switzerland in Azerbaijan

"In 2019, we celebrated the 20th anniversary of international cooperation between Switzerland and Azerbaijan. In 1999, when this cooperation had just begun, the emphasis was on the humanitarian sphere. This was directly related to the support of refugees and internally displaced persons," she said.

"As Azerbaijan develops, this cooperation is aimed at implementing long-term projects. We began to cooperate in the areas of water infrastructure and vocational education. For example, in 2000-2011, Switzerland provided $4 million in support for the restoration of the kariz [underground hydraulic system] in the Nakhchivan Autonomous Republic," the ambassador added.

Peneveyre also noted that with the further development of the Azerbaijani economy, cooperation between Switzerland and Azerbaijan began to expand in the economic and technical spheres.

"In general, over 22 years of this cooperation, Switzerland has invested in the Azerbaijani economy in the amount of $110 million, which were directed to support 90 projects," she said.
